Официально представлен релиз дистрибутива Scientific Linux 7.4, построенного на пакетной базе Red Hat Enterprise Linux 7.4 и дополненного средствами, ориентированными на использование в научных учреждениях. Изначально новую версию планировалось выпустить в августе, но собранные iso-образы не прошли контроль качества (в RHEL 7.4 всплыли серьёзные проблемы в работе конфигураций с iptables) и выпуск был отложен.

Дистрибутив поставляется для архитектуры x86_64, в форме DVD-сборок (8.4 Гб и 7.2 Гб), сокращённого образа для установки по сети (451 Мб). Публикация Live-сборок задерживается. Формирование DVD-сборок размером 4.7 Гб прекращено, для записи образа на USB-накопитель предлагается использовать утилиту livecd-iso-to-disk.

Отличия от RHEL в основной массе сводятся к ребрендингу и чистке привязок к службам Red Hat. Специфичные для научного применения приложения, а также дополнительные драйверы, предлагаются для установки из внешних репозиториев, таких как EPEL и elrepo.org.

Основные особенности Scientific Linux 7.4:

  • Компоненты (shim, grub2, ядро Linux), используемые при загрузке в режиме UEFI Secure Boot, подписаны новым ключом Scientific Linux, что требует выполнения ручных операций, так как данный ключ необходимо добавить в прошивку;
  • Пакеты с iptables пересобраны с исправлением, устраняющим проблему, из-за которой правила пакетного фильтра не загружались (но сервис стартовал без ошибок) при одновременном использовании в системе iptables и ip6tables (IPv4 и IPv6);
  • OpenAFS, открытая реализация распределенной ФС Andrew File System, обновлена до версии 1.6.21;
  • Осуществлён ребрендинг файлов с подсказками к инсталлятору Anaconda, в которых оставались незамеченным упоминания RHEL;
  • Добавлен пакет SL_gdm_no_user_list, отключающий отображение списка пользователей в GDM при необходимости соблюдения более строгой политики безопасности;
  • Добавлен пакет SL_enable_serialconsole для настройки консоли, работающей через последовательный порт;
  • Добавлен пакет SL_no_colorls, отключающий цветной вывод в ls;
  • Для автоматической установки обновлений задействована система yum-cron, вместо yum-autoupdate. По умолчанию обновления применяются автоматически с последующей отправкой уведомления пользователю. Для изменения поведения на этапе автоматизированной установки, подготовлены пакеты SL_yum-cron_no_automated_apply_updates (запрещает автоматическую установку обновлений) и SL_yum-cron_no_default_excludes (разрешает установку обновлений с ядром);
  • Файлы с конфигурацией внешних репозиториев (EPEL, ELRepo, SL-Extras, SL-SoftwareCollections, ZFSonLinux) перемещены в централизованное хранилище, так как данные репозитории не специфичны для конкретных выпусков и могут использоваться с любыми версиями Scientific Linux 7. Для загрузки данных о репозиториях следует выполнить "yum install yum-conf-repos", а затем настроить отдельные репозитории, например, "yum install yum-conf-epel yum-conf-zfsonlinux yum-conf-softwarecollections yum-conf-hc yum-conf-extras yum-conf-elrepo";
  • Внесены изменения в пакеты, в основном связанные с ребрендингом: anaconda, dhcp, grub2, httpd, ipa, kernel, libreport, PackageKit, pesign, plymouth, redhat-rpm-config, shim, yum, cockpit;
  • По сравнению с веткой Scientific Linux 6.x из базового состава исключены пакеты alpine, SL_desktop_tweaks, SL_password_for_singleuser, yum-autoupdate, yum-conf-adobe, thunderbird (доступен в репозитории EPEL7).


Источник: http://www.opennet.ru/opennews/art.shtml?num=47312